Attendance at new MLB ballparks

by Steve Mullis, Minnesota Public Radio
July 16, 2010

This year the Minnesota Twins expect more than three million fans to come Target Field in downtown Minneapolis to watch the team - up from 2.4 million last year in the Metrodome. That's typical of the increase new ballparks enjoy in their first year. But a sustained boost isn't the guarantee that it was 10 or 15 years ago.

Over the last decade, several teams -- including Milwaukee and Pittsburgh -- have seen attendance drop off 20 percent or more as soon as the second year after opening a new ballpark.
